He’s a pioneer of Australian pub rock, and one of the most treasured song-writers this country has to claim. Don Walker, the man who penned the lyrics to iconic songs like Khe Sah and Cheap Wine, joins The Betoota Advocate podcast to tell us how it all started. How did Cold Chisel form? Where did he write those songs? This great Australian storyteller details the whole journey. From North Queensland, to Grafton, to Armidale, Adelaide and then Kings Cross.
